
LAKEPORT, Calif. – The winners of the city of Lakeport's annual lighted holiday decorating contest were announced on Tuesday night at the Lakeport City Council meeting.
This year’s winners include the Rocky Point Care Center, 625 16th St., which took first place in the business category for an elegant display running across its entire facade.
Second place for businesses went to Main Street Bicycles at 125 N. Main for its homey window scene with fireplace and Christmas tree.
The beautiful winter wonderland at the Mills home, 1190 N. Brush St., took first place in the residential category.
The Bussard home at 842 Central Park Ave., which for several years has been listed amongst the contest's top finishers, took second place for its multifaceted light show timed to holiday music.
First place winners were awarded $300 each and second place winners received $100 each.
The contest is sponsored by the city of Lakeport, the Lakeport Main Street Association and the Lake County Chamber of Commerce.
